This Is What You Must Definitely Know in Your 20s
In your 20s, you’re constantly told: You can do anything, be anything, and go anywhere. It sounds motivating, doesn’t it? But when it comes down to it, is this really helpful advice?
At first, I bought into it. I believed if I worked hard enough, I could shape myself into anything. But then, I came across a quote that completely changed the way I thought about success and fulfillment:
“You can’t be anything you want, but you can be a lot more of who you already are.”
That simple statement hit me deeply. It made me realize that I had been chasing an ideal that didn’t align with who I truly am.
Breaking Free from Unrealistic Expectations
After graduation, I jumped into the mindset that if I just worked hard enough, I could achieve anything. I was inspired by the stories of people defying the odds — those underdog success stories where sheer effort led to remarkable accomplishments. Naturally, I assumed I could do the same.
So, I pushed myself into areas that didn’t really suit my natural strengths. I took on challenges that I wasn’t naturally inclined towards, thinking that effort alone would get me where I wanted to be.
